The binding of Na+, K+, and Li+ by magnesium silicate hydrate (M-S-H) was investigated in batch sorption experiments. Sorption isotherms and cation exchange measurements indicated the binding of alkalis in cation exchange sites compensating the negative surface charge of M-S-H. Higher pH values led to further deprotonation of the silanol groups and a higher alkali uptake by M-S-H. No significant incorporation of alkalis in the main silica or magnesium oxide sheets was observed. However, the silica sheets were less polymerized in the presence of higher alkali hydroxide concentrations.
